How to pack a comic book for shipping?

First, wrap the comic book in acid-free tissue paper. Then, place it in a box that's slightly larger than the book. Add foam peanuts or crumpled paper for cushioning. Seal the box with strong tape.

How heavy is a 200-page manga?

It really depends on a lot of factors. The weight can vary based on the paper quality, size of the pages, and the type of printing. But generally, it could be around a few hundred grams.
